Due to an increased demand within our business, SYPAQ are seeking a Communications Network Engineer to work on a Defence project. The contract is upto June 2027 plus potential extensions. This is an office based role in Canberra.
Overview: Our Client are seeking an experienced specialist in Communications and Data Networks and Integration to provide expertise into the production, review, update and management of their capability project documentation and supporting artefacts (including the conduct of workshops as required). This role will provide specialist systems engineering,
technical support for integration and interoperability to support the design and development of coherent and integrated IAMD architecture across the Integrated Force. Activities will focus on capability definition, requirements development, systems integration, architecture development, technical analysis and stakeholder engagement within a Joint system-of-systems environment.
The role will contribute to Communications and Data Networks and Integration of IAMD systems, and Air, Land and Sea Weapon Systems (e.g. GBAD) and should include experience in:
- conduct of communications and data network, bearer and system integration development
- conduct requirements analysis for IAMD C2 networks, bearers and integration
- conduct system design for the integration of sensors and weapons systems across all domains into an IAMD architecture
- support Tactical Data Links and Defence Networks and related engineering services
- conduct review of contract deliverables
- support to analysis, review and concept development of multi-domain systems integrated within IAMD C2
- support to certification of networks and integration standards
- Assist in the development, review and maintenance of IAMD networks and integrated capabilities across a broad range of technical disciplines including networks, sensing, Integrated Fire Control, weapons data link, Security and Command and Control.
- Assisting the IAMD Program and Capability Development Division (across all Branches) with conducting both IAMD network and integration capability analysis, research and development. Collaborate with Force Integration and Force Design Divisions, Defence Science & Technology Group and other relevant Stakeholders in development and progression of such networks and integration requirements.
- Deliver technical assessments, design reviews, trade studies, configuration-controlled interface definitions and artefacts (e.g. OCDs), and systems engineering inputs to mature and de-risk integration options and requirements.
